About This Item
New York: Abercrombie and Fitch, 1966. Undetermined. fine. 1966 edition reprinted from Racque and Tennis Club copy. xii,324pp. Octavo. Three quarter cloth binding, tan with red on spine. Front has red lettering and black decoration, and spine has black decoration and lettering. Corners are slightly bumped. B&W photos and illustrations throughout and colour fold out map at back. fine The prince of San Donato's narrative of an 1897 hunting trip into Central Asia. An intriguing account due to the Victorian mindset of the time. 1966
